The challenge for any serious options trader is managing execution risk, which is the financial exposure created when only a portion of a multi-leg strategy is filled. A partially completed trade results in an entirely different position than the one intended, instantly altering the risk and profit profile. A vertical spread might become an unhedged long call. An iron condor might become a simple short put.

These unintended outcomes introduce immediate, uncalculated risk. Atomic execution systems, particularly those using a Request for Quote (RFQ) model, directly address this vulnerability. By grouping all legs of a trade into a single order, they present the entire strategic package to liquidity providers. The result is a single price for the entire structure, filled in one definitive action. Structuring Complex Spreads with Absolute Fidelity

Multi-leg options strategies derive their unique risk-reward characteristics from the interplay of their constituent parts. An iron condor, for example, is a carefully balanced structure of four different options contracts. Its defined-risk profile is entirely dependent on all four legs being executed simultaneously at a specific net credit. Legging into such a trade piece by piece on the open market is fraught with risk.

A sudden market move between fills can dramatically alter the cost basis or leave the position dangerously unbalanced. Atomic execution through an RFQ system removes this risk entirely. The entire four-legged structure is submitted as a single package. Market makers bid on the package, providing a single net price for the condor itself.

A successful fill means all four legs are established at once, preserving the strategy’s intended structure and risk parameters from the outset. This method provides the certainty required to systematically deploy defined-risk strategies and compound returns over time.

Using a Request for Quote system for a 5,000-lot spread can result in price improvement of several cents over the National Best Bid and Offer, translating into substantial savings on large trades.

This same principle applies to any multi-leg options strategy, including:

  • Vertical Spreads ▴ Ensuring the long and short options are executed at a specific debit or credit, locking in the maximum gain and loss profile.
  • Butterflies and Condors ▴ Guaranteeing the integrity of these four-legged structures to maintain their precise risk and reward zones.
  • Calendar and Diagonal Spreads ▴ Securing the price relationship between different expiration dates, which is the core of the strategy.

Executing Block Trades without Market Impact

Large options orders, or block trades, present a unique challenge. Placing a large order directly on the public market can signal your intent to other participants, who may move prices against you before your order is fully filled. This phenomenon, known as information leakage, results in slippage and a higher average cost. The RFQ process is the professional solution.

By privately soliciting quotes from a curated set of liquidity providers, you can get a block-sized order filled at a single, competitive price. The trade is negotiated off the public order book and then printed to the exchange, ensuring that the market does not move against you during execution. This method provides both price certainty and size, allowing for the efficient deployment of institutional-scale positions without the costly consequence of market impact. The Economic Advantage of Unified Pricing

The benefits of atomic execution extend beyond risk management into direct economic advantages. By soliciting competitive bids through an RFQ, traders often achieve price improvement ▴ an execution price superior to the public National Best Bid and Offer (NBBO). Market makers competing for your order flow will frequently tighten their spreads to win the trade, passing those savings directly to you. Over hundreds of trades, this seemingly small edge accumulates into a significant positive impact on your portfolio’s performance.

Furthermore, many brokers offer reduced commission structures for packaged multi-leg trades compared to executing each leg individually. The combination of reduced slippage, potential price improvement, and lower transaction costs creates a powerful economic tailwind for the disciplined trader. Integrating Atomic Execution into Portfolio Hedging

Effective hedging is precise and timely. When a portfolio needs protection, a trader might deploy a collar strategy, which involves selling a call option against a long stock position and using the proceeds to buy a protective put. This three-part structure (long stock, short call, long put) must be managed with precision. Using an atomic, multi-leg order to establish or adjust the options portion of the collar ensures that the hedge is applied exactly as intended.

There is no risk of the short call being filled while the protective put is missed, which would leave the portfolio exposed to downside risk without the intended protection. By executing the entire options structure as a single unit, you ensure the cost of the hedge is known and the protective structure is perfectly in place. Atomic Execution

Meaning ▴ Atomic execution refers to a computational operation that guarantees either complete success of all its constituent parts or complete failure, with no intermediate or partial states.

Execution Risk

Meaning ▴ Execution Risk quantifies the potential for an order to not be filled at the desired price or quantity, or within the anticipated timeframe, thereby incurring adverse price slippage or missed trading opportunities.

Iron Condor

Meaning ▴ The Iron Condor represents a non-directional, limited-risk, limited-profit options strategy designed to capitalize on an underlying asset's price remaining within a specified range until expiration.

Request for Quote System

Meaning ▴ A Request for Quote System represents a structured electronic mechanism designed to facilitate bilateral or multilateral price discovery for financial instruments, enabling a principal to solicit firm, executable bids and offers from a pre-selected group of liquidity providers within a defined time window, specifically for instruments where continuous public price formation is either absent or inefficient.

Price Improvement

Meaning ▴ Price improvement denotes the execution of a trade at a more advantageous price than the prevailing National Best Bid and Offer (NBBO) at the moment of order submission.
